What is a mobile applications developer?

A Mobile Applications Developer is a software professional who designs, creates, tests, and maintains applications for mobile devices such as smartphones and tablets. They work with platforms like iOS and Android, using programming languages such as Swift, Kotlin, or Java. Their responsibilities include collaborating with designers and other developers, optimizing app performance, and ensuring user-friendly interfaces. Mobile application developers play a key role in delivering seamless digital experiences to users on the go.

What are some common challenges mobile applications developers face when collaborating with cross-functional teams?

Mobile Applications Developers often work closely with designers, product managers, and backend engineers. A common challenge is ensuring clear communication about project requirements, design specifications, and technical constraints, as misunderstandings can lead to delays or rework. Additionally, coordinating updates and synchronizing release timelines across different platforms (iOS and Android) requires strong collaboration and agile practices. Regular stand-ups, documentation, and version control tools help teams stay aligned and address issues promptly.

How do I become a mobile applications developer?

A mobile applications developer typically needs a strong foundation in programming languages such as Java, Swift, or Kotlin, and experience with mobile development frameworks like Android Studio or Xcode. Earning a relevant degree in computer science or software engineering and building a portfolio of mobile apps can improve job prospects. Familiarity with app design, testing, and deployment processes is also important.
